B
"The
queuing
delays
are
a
tiny
part
of
your
total
hours
of
life,
so
don't
let
them
be
a
major
source
of
anxiety,"
says
Richard
Larson,
who
has
studied
queuing
for
40
years.
Larson
came
up
with
mathematical
methods
for
predicting
what
he
calls
slips
and
skips,
where
a
newcomer
arrives
after
you
but
gets
the
service
first.
Such
cutting
doesn't
need
to
be
intentional
to
feel
unjust.
“If
you
are
the
victim,
you
suffer
a
psychological
cost,"
Larson
says.
“You
can
get
angry
or
even
violent"
Just
relax
instead.
Larson
has
noticed
more
and
more
queues
that
allow
people
to
buy
their
way
into
a
faster
lane.
He's
unsure
whether
that
could
change
the
culture
of
how
Americans
line
up,
but
it
might.
A
well-
designed
line
makes
cheating
nearly
impossible.
If
you
find
yourself
in
a
long
line,
a
queue
to
get
hundreds
of
millions
of
people
vaccinated
(接种疫苗)
for
Covid-19,
be
patient.
Don't
try
to
cut
ahead
of
others
just
because
no
one
is
standing
behind
you
to
see
it.
While
you
wait,
let
yourself
be
distracted
(分心)
by
a
book,
music
or
whatever
occupies
your
mind.
Sometimes,
distraction
is
built
in
by
designers.
If
you
find
yourself
growing
disappointed
in
a
line,
look
behind
you.
The
more
people
you
see,
the
more
likely
you
are
to
stay
in
line
and
maybe
even
be
pleased
with
your
position.
Sometimes
great
human
experiences
are
shared
while
waiting
in
line.
Larson
recently
got
his
Covid-19
vaccination.
Normally,
he
tends
to
avoid
queues,
but
he
relished
this
one.
Many
around
him
were
elderly,
some
in
wheelchairs,
some
with
helpers.
There
was
excitement
on
their
faces
as
they
waited
together,
a
lightness
that
only
comes
when
fear
begins
to
lift.

C
Outside
an
art
museum
in
Topeka,
Kansas,
some
kids
are
playing
happily
in
what
looks
like
a
large
Hobbit
House
while
others
are
walking
through
the
house's
woven
(编织)
archway
into
a
twisted
twig
(嫩枝)
tower.
The
tower,
made
entirely
of
sticks,
is
a
sculpture
built
by
Dougherty.
Dougherty
has
created
more
than
200
stick
sculptures
all
over
the
world.
“I
design
my
sculptures
to
look
like
they've
always
been
there,”
he
says.
And
he
likes
people
to
get
involved
in
his
work.
If
they
arrive
during
the
three
weeks
he
takes
to
build
a
sculpture,
he
lets
them
build,
too.

I
want
my
work
to
help
people
enjoy
nature.”
As
a
child,
Dougherty
learned
to
love
nature
while
traveling
through
the
woods.
He
would
spend
hours
bending
sticks
into
shelters
for
his
brothers
and
sisters.
When
he
grew
up,
he
majored
in
art
and
learnt
to
make
sculptures
with
clay.
But
it
was
too
heavy
to
make
the
lines
and
shapes
he
imagined.
One
day,
he
watched
thin,
young
trees
waving
in
the
wind.
They
reminded
him
of
the
sticks
he
built
shelters
with
as
a
boy.
Soon
after,
he
began
his
first
creation
made
out
of
sticks.
To
begin
a
sculpture,
Dougherty
digs
holes
and
buries
tall
young
trees
in
the
ground
for
support.
Then
he
weaves
(编织)
smaller
sticks
around
them.
He
uses
strings
to
hold
and
bend
the
twigs
while
he's
weaving.
When
he
removes
the
string,
the
sticks
stay
in
place.
It
usually
takes
four
tons
of
sticks
to
build
a
sculpture,
and
Dougherty
chooses
materials
that
would
otherwise
be
wasted.
Dougherty's
sculptures
last
two
to
four
years.
But
even
after
that,
they
serve
a
purpose.
The
wood
is
cut
up
into
tiny
pieces
called
mulch
(覆盖料),
which
makes
soil
rich
and
helps
new
plants
grow
after
it
breaks
down.

D
Nowadays,
we
needn't
look
far
to
find
something
new
to
watch.
So
why
do
so
many
of
us
choose
to
watch
films
we’ve
already
seen,
even
knowing
every
line
of
the
script?
A
survey
revealed
rewatching
films
we've
already
seen
countless
times
is
common.
Some
titles
were
mentioned
repeatedly—Back
To
The
Future,
Top
Gun,
and
musicals
like
The
Rain.
In
2016,a
website
surveyed
1,169
people
to
list
the
25
most
rewatched
films—with
Star
Wars,
The
Wizard
of
Oz
and
The
sound
of
Music
taking
the
top
spots.
Finding
which
movies
we
watch
again
and
again
is
easy.
Exactly
why
we
do
it
is
less
clear.
Obviously
we
love
them
and
think
they
deserve
our
attention.
One
said,“Some
films
are
what
I
Think
‘complete’
and
are
so
familiar
that
you
can
stop
and
start
at
any
point.
They
are
deeply
satisfying
and
you
can
lose
yourself
in
them.”
While
that
might
explain
the
second,
third,
or
fourth
viewing,
what
keeps
us
coming
back
to
a
movie
when
we
already
know
every
detail,
and
there
are
so
many
other
new
films
to
choose
from?
One
explanation
is
that
watching
something
familiar
takes
up
less
mental
energy.
We
don't
have
to
concentrate
to
work
out
what's
going
on.
Instead,
we
just
sit
back
and
relax.
When
faced
with
diverse
choices,
it's
easier
to
return
to
an
old
film
that
we
believe
won
t
disappoint
us.
A
psychological
phenomenon,
“the
mere
exposure
effect”—
in
which
we
develop
a
preference
for
something
familiar—could
also
be
a
good
explanation.
So
the
more
we
watch,
the
more
we
want
to
watch.
A
2012
study
on
cultural
“re-consumption
found
that
rewatching
movies
can
also
make
us
reflect
on
how
we've
grown—a
measuring
stick
for
how
much
our
lives
have
changed.
Perhaps
that's
one
of
the
biggest
reasons
why
we
return
to
films,
to
recall
not
only
for
a
time
in
history
but
for
a
time
in
our
lives.
